WEST LAFAYETTE, Ind. - After a week off, the Purdue women's tennis team will be back in action Saturday when they hit the road to take on No. 25 Tulsa. The 38th-ranked Boilermakers take a 1-1 record into battle against the 6-2 Golden Hurricane at the Case Center. First serves are scheduled for 12: 30 p.m. ET with live scoring and a live video stream available.
For the third time in as many duals, the Old Gold & Black will be going up against a highly touted squad, already taking on then-No. 14 Clemson and No. T-42 Washington at the ITA Kick-Off Weekend Jan. 24-25. Purdue defeated the Huskies, 4-2, but dropped a 5-0 dual to the Tigers.
Like the Boilermakers, the Golden Hurricane had a 1-1 performance while playing in the ITA Kick-Off Weekend. They edged then-No. T-42 Utah (4-3) and suffered a 4-2 loss to then-No. 16 and host Michigan. Tulsa comes in after being blanked by No. 6 Baylor on the road, 4-0, for its second loss of the season on Feb. 1. The Golden Hurricane boast a 4-0 mark at the Case Center thus far.
Purdue heads to Tulsa looking to repay the Golden Hurricane with a loss on their home court. Last year in their first-ever meeting, Tulsa defeated the Boilermakers, 5-2, on the Basham Courts.
No. 105 Andjela Djokovic and No. 118 Daniela Vidal will be leading the Purdue revenge charge. Tess Bernard-Feigenbaum and Vidal both own a 4-1 record playing at Nos. 1 and 2, respectively. They are also 5-2 as the No. 1 doubles team for the Old Gold & Black.
There is one ranked Golden Hurricane that will be in action, No. 70 Marcelina Cichon.
